Mark Cuban has laid out a challenge. Seth Godin is blogging about it. Dave Ramsey was on Good Morning America, encouraging it.
Cuban is challenging people to develop a business plan that will be profitable in 90 days. During the first 90 days he might help fund it.
Godin comments on the comments and points out how it's a shame that so many naysayers are "calling Cuban's bluff."
Ramsey says in his interview, it's the perfect time for the next Bill Gates or Michael Dell to start a business in his garage or dorm room.
I bet if you create a business plan that is profitable in 90 days, you can also figure out how to do it with out any venture capital. You're a smart person. Go do it.
